Frequently asked questionsabout travel between Dover and Bournemouth

There are several options for getting from Dover to Bournemouth by train, bus and car. The cheapest option is to take the bus which costs around £19 ($23) and will take around 5h 15m. If you need to get there more quickly, you can drive and arrive in approximately 2h 55m, though it is a bit more costly at approximately £49 ($58).

The distance between Dover and Bournemouth is around 283km (176 miles). In a direct line (as the crow flies), the distance is 228km (142 miles)

It takes around 3h 20m to get from Dover and Bournemouth by train. If you are travelling by car it will take around 2h 55m to drive there.

The quickest way to get from Dover to Bournemouth is to drive which takes around 2h 55m and will set you back approx £49 ($58).

The cheapest way to travel between Dover and Bournemouth, if you exclude driving, is to take the bus which will typically cost around £19 ($23) for a standard one-way ticket.

Train travel

Yes there is a train service that runs between Dover and Bournemouth. It typically takes around 3h 20m and departs hourly.

There are no direct train services that runs from Dover to Bournemouth. However, you can instead can take several connecting trains with a changeover in Stratford International, Stratford station and Waterloo station. These services run hourly and will take a minimum of 3h 20m.

South Eastern Trains Service, South Western Railway, Southern Service and CrossCountry run train services between Dover and Bournemouth. Trains depart hourly and will take around 3h 20m, however, this may vary depending on the particular service and whether it runs express or stops all stations.

Bus travel

Yes there is a bus that runs regularly from Dover and Bournemouth. It typically takes around 5h 15m and departs every 3 hours.

There are no direct bus services that runs from Dover to Bournemouth. However, you can instead can take several connecting buses with changeovers in Canterbury Bus Station and London Victoria Coach Station. These services run every 3 hours and will take a minimum of 5h 15m.

National Express and Megabus UK run regular bus services between Dover and Bournemouth. Buses run every 3 hours and take around 5h 15m on average but will vary depending on you book with.
